Most Cast Members accept 2-3 events a month – although many choose to work far more or less, depending on their schedules.<br>Requirements & Next Steps<br>Character Performer Application<br>Our Character Performers are more than just party princesses. They are highly trained magic makers who bring our favourite characters to life. To a child, you are the character you are portraying, and our performers keep that belief alive. Their day to day duties include:<br>> Portraying specific costumed character roles<br>> Signing autographs and posing for photographs<br>> Interacting with guests<br>> Running games and activities where the event requires<br>> Maintaining show quality and character integrity (you’ll learn what this means in training!)<br>> Performing for audiences, such as storytimes or singing specific character songs<br>No two events are the same, which makes this role so exciting! You could be playing a princess at a party one day, running games and telling stories, and the next you’re at a busy shopping centre posing for photos and signing autographs.<br>Pixie Dust Parties Character Performers must be 18-years-of-age (or older) with reliable transportation, and a clean criminal background. All applicants should be willing to or have already had an enhanced DBS check. Experience working with children, customer service, or in the performing arts / theatre is preferred. We are proud to have opportunities on our team for performers of all ages, heights, body-types, and ethnicities.<br>Singing ability is not required but will definitely get you ahead in the game, as we love our princess performers to be able to sing their own songs as opposed to lip-syncing where possible.<br>Applicants who live within 20 miles of our base in Bath are preferred – although we do compensate for travel for performers who are located outside of that 20 mile radius.<br>Ready to join the magic?
